New Delhi, India (Rail & Metro Today): India’s first high-speed rail corridor has crossed another major construction milestone, with 365 km of viaduct completed on the 508-km Mumbai-Ahmedabad High-Speed Rail (MAHSR) corridor, according to the National High Speed Rail Corporation Limited (NHSRCL) progress report for August 2026.
The project, being developed to support train operations at speeds of up to 320 kmph, is progressing across Gujarat, Maharashtra and the Union Territory of Dadra and Nagar Haveli. The first passenger services are targeted for August 2027 on the initial Surat–Vapi section, while completion of the entire Mumbai–Ahmedabad corridor is targeted for December 2029.
NHSRCL’s August 2026 progress figures indicate that construction has advanced substantially across the corridor. About 455 km of pier work has been completed, while 365 km of viaduct is now ready.
The project has also recorded 299 km of noise barriers, along with the completion of 15 steel bridges and 17 river bridges. Four mountain tunnels have been excavated, while approximately 5 km of tunnel work has been completed using the New Austrian Tunnelling Method.
Track-related construction is also progressing. Around 222 km of reinforced concrete track bed has been completed, with 98 km of track slabs laid using CAM injection.
The electrification package has crossed another important milestone, with more than 9,100 overhead electrification (OHE) masts installed across 203 km. The complete corridor is planned to have more than 20,000 OHE masts.
These figures represent an increase over the July 2026 progress figures cited in Parliament, when pier work stood at 452 km, girder work at 356 km, track bed construction at 209 km and OHE mast installation at 190 km.
The initial passenger service is planned on the Surat–Vapi section, with the section expected to be completed before the first train trials.
Railway Minister Ashwini Vaishnaw has said that construction of the Vapi–Surat section is targeted for completion by December 2026, after which testing and commissioning activities would follow. The planned inaugural service in August 2027 is expected to cover around 100 km, while official project documentation identifies the section as approximately 97 km.
The Surat–Bilimora stretch has also been identified separately as an important section expected to enter service in 2027.
The MAHSR corridor is planned to open in phases. The sequence described in official project information includes the initial Vapi–Surat section, followed by Vapi–Ahmedabad, Thane–Ahmedabad and eventually the complete Mumbai–Ahmedabad corridor.
The first operations on the initial section are planned with India’s indigenous B28 high-speed trainset, which has been designed for a maximum test speed of 280 kmph.
BEML is manufacturing the trainset at its Aditya High-Speed Rail Complex in Bengaluru. The first body frame has reportedly been completed and sent for structural testing, with track trials expected around May–June 2027.
On 18 September 2026, BEML announced an order worth more than ₹5,400 crore from NHSRCL covering the supply and maintenance of high-speed rolling stock and allied works for the corridor. The Japanese E10 Shinkansen remains part of the longer-term rolling stock plan.
The MAHSR corridor will connect Bandra Kurla Complex (BKC) in Mumbai with Sabarmati in Ahmedabad over approximately 508 km. The alignment passes through Maharashtra, Gujarat and the Union Territory of Dadra and Nagar Haveli.
Nearly 90% of the alignment is elevated, with the remainder comprising tunnels, bridges and station areas. One of the project's most technically significant components is the approximately 21-km Mumbai-side tunnel, which includes an undersea section beneath Thane Creek.
The corridor will have 12 stations:
Mumbai BKC, Thane, Virar, Boisar, Vapi, Bilimora, Surat, Bharuch, Vadodara, Anand, Ahmedabad and Sabarmati.
The trains are designed for speeds of up to 350 kmph, with commercial operations planned at up to 320 kmph. According to statements by the Railway Minister, the fastest service between Mumbai and Ahmedabad is planned to take approximately 1 hour 58 minutes with four stops, while a service stopping at all 12 stations would take around 2 hours 17 minutes.
The MAHSR corridor will use India’s first 2×25 kV high-speed overhead traction system, designed for operations at up to 320 kmph.
Power will be supplied from the national grid through dedicated traction substations located along the corridor. More than 20,000 OHE masts are planned across the project, with over 9,100 already installed as of August 2026.
The high-speed electrification system is being developed as an integral part of the corridor’s signalling, track and rolling-stock requirements, enabling the railway to operate at substantially higher speeds than conventional Indian railway services.
The Mumbai–Ahmedabad High-Speed Rail project was launched in 2017 and originally had a 2023 completion target. The schedule was subsequently affected by delays, including land acquisition issues in Maharashtra.
The project has since accelerated, with Gujarat recording substantial progress in stations and civil structures. Structural work has been completed at Sabarmati, Ahmedabad, Vadodara and Bharuch, while finishing and track-related works are progressing. Track work has also begun at Surat, Bilimora and Bharuch.
In Maharashtra, construction activity is progressing on piers, stations and the major tunnel package.

The immediate focus is now on completing the Vapi–Surat construction package by December 2026, followed by testing and train trials targeted around May–June 2027. If the current schedule is maintained, the first passenger service could begin in August 2027, ahead of the targeted December 2029 completion of the full Mumbai–Ahmedabad corridor.
The MAHSR project is therefore moving from large-scale civil construction towards an increasingly integrated phase involving track, electrification, rolling stock, signalling, testing and commissioning. Its eventual commissioning will establish India’s first operational high-speed rail corridor and provide a new benchmark for future high-speed rail projects in the country.
